Scrub for the skin: yogurt, sugar and honey
Let's start with some do-it-yourself beauty remedy made of very sweet flavors. It is evident that the part of our body that immediately summarizes our health condition is the skin. Our skin speaks about us: at this time of year it is important to keep it ready and reactive to prevent any injury that the sun can cause. First of all, what would be good for the skin to prepare it for the sun, is a small DIY beauty recipe that contains the effect of a scrub.
Here is the recipe: mix yogurt (preferably whole white) and coarse-grained cane sugar in a bowl, gently massage on the face and around the lips, rinse and then apply honey that serves to nourish the skin well and avoid redness. Apply at least five minutes, wash your face with warm water and apply rose water with a cotton ball.
As an alternative to rose water, rosemary and thyme are perfect as decongestants. In half a liter of water, boil two or three sprigs of rosemary and a handful of thyme, leave to cool and then wipe the face with a cotton ball.
Egg masks: toning with the yolk and against redness with white
To make a toning mask you need to take an egg yolk, beat it in a bowl with two tablespoons of olive oil and put it all over your face and neck. Keep the mixture about twenty minutes and then rinse.
In the meantime, don't throw away the white: if you have invited a friend of yours for your DIY day, whip the white wine, take a cucumber, cut it into small pieces and add a tablespoon of milk and rose water ; stirring the preparation, proceed by placing it on two or three layers of gauze that will rest on your face. It is a fantastic DIY beauty mask, anti-fatigue and anti-reddening.
Plums and tomatoes against large pores and oily skins
Summer also includes plums, particularly black plums, rich in antioxidants, potassium, vitamins A, C, B1, B2 and PP, which deeply nourish the dermis. Then take a small saucepan and boil five black plums, collect the pulp and, once it has cooled, add a few drops of sweet almond oil, apply the mixture to the face for about twenty minutes. Wash it all off with rose water.
To achieve a simple and effective mask against greasy skins, proceed as follows : r receive the juice of half a lemon with that of two tomatoes and spread it carefully on the nose, cheeks, chin and forehead; let it absorb for half an hour and rinse with cold water.
